Internship, Battery Engineering (Summer 2026)

Tesla is seeking highly motivated engineering students for their Internship program in Battery Engineering. Interns will work directly with full-time engineers to design, prototype, test, and launch new battery components and processes, contributing to innovative energy storage solutions.

Responsibilities

Work directly with full time engineers to design, prototype, test and launch new parts and processes to improve our batteries
Projects include high voltage conductors, advanced cooling systems, cell interfaces, and battery enclosures

Required

Currently pursuing a degree in Mechanical Engineering or a related field
Proficiency in computer aided design software such as CAD, NX, Fusion360, SolidWorks, CATIA
Experience in STARCCM+, COMSOL, MATLAB, Simulink, Ansys
Proven interest in hands on engineering through project teams, academic projects, passion projects, or equivalent experiences
Strong knowledge of engineering fundamentals, such as statics, dynamics, fluid dynamics, heat transfer, and material properties
Familiarity with and interest in HV battery systems, hardware testing, quality assurance, metrology, exposure to mass production environments
Previous experience in a lab R&D environment, such as an internship or undergraduate research
Strong technical communication skills
Genuine curiosity and willingness to understand how our products are designed, built and how they operate

Preferred

Experience with polymer materials, characterization techniques, and adhesives testing/formulating desired
